Transaction e8f41a692104384e8fabca1d841788b4958e959430d002058edc084536439882
1 Input
2 Outputs
- e8f41a692104384e8fabca1d841788b4958e959430d002058edc084536439882:0
- e8f41a692104384e8fabca1d841788b4958e959430d002058edc084536439882:1
value 22919840
address 19KQiHeqE8PHT2HAELzxRTyXoigYq9gyTL
value 64356000
address 38kruzvV79n5YH8w9qPrDpBTrnF4p8LFw8